1851 CENSUS

Full details of entries found in the 1851 Census for the Wirksworth Area, which includes the following places in Derbyshire, England:

Alderwasley, Ashlehay, Biggin, Bonsall, Brassington, Callow, Carsington, Cromford,
Griffe Grange, Hopton, Hulland Ward, Ible, Idridghay, Ireton Wood, Ironbrook,
Kirk Ireton, Matlock, Middleton, Shottle, Tansley and Wirksworth.

These parts of the Census contain 36 enumeration districts with 16,103 entries.

EXPLANATION of LAYOUT

Code   Firstname  SURNAME  Relation Con Age Sex Occupation          Where born          Comments

Ad01a  Job        PEAT     Head       M  61  M  Farmer of 100 acres Ashleyhay           Empl 3 labourers


Number---Address------[Place]-----(page, Registrar's District, Enumeration District, Home Office number)

#001---Knobb Farm---[Alderwasley]---(p1, Wirksworth district, Enumeration district 3, HO 107/2145)

In the Census, each household is given a #"number of Householders Schedule". A Page Reference number is given, each page holding about 20 entries. Registrar's District, Enumeration District and Home Office reference number are also present. All this information is given in the listing in red. The Home Office (Public Record Office) number can be used to order microfilm of the Census from the PRO, or view at a reference library.
